Song meaning for Ain't No Sunshine by Bill Withers

"Ain't No Sunshine" by Bill Withers is a soulful and melancholic song that explores the emptiness and darkness that ensues when a loved one is absent. The repetitive phrase "Ain't no sunshine when she's gone" serves as the central theme, emphasizing the profound impact the woman's absence has on the narrator's life.

The lyrics vividly convey the sense of coldness and desolation that accompanies her departure. Withers sings, "It's not warm when she's away," highlighting the absence of warmth and comfort in his life when she is not present. The repetition of "Ain't no sunshine" further emphasizes the void that is left behind, as if the sun itself has disappeared from his world.

The lyrics also express the narrator's uncertainty and longing for the woman's return. He wonders, "Wonder this time where she's gone, wonder if she's gonna stay." This line reflects his yearning for her presence and his fear of losing her permanently. The repetition of "Anytime she goes away" emphasizes the recurring nature of her absence, suggesting that this is a recurring pattern in their relationship.

The bridge of the song adds a layer of self-awareness to the lyrics. Withers acknowledges that he should "leave the young thing alone," implying that the woman may not be good for him or their relationship. However, he cannot help but be drawn to her, as he sings, "But ain't no sunshine when she's gone." This line suggests that despite the potential harm she may cause, he cannot deny the profound impact she has on his life.

In the final verse, the lyrics become even more somber, with Withers singing, "Only darkness everyday." This line conveys the depth of despair and loneliness that the narrator experiences in the absence of his loved one. The repetition of "Anytime she goes away" in the outro further emphasizes the recurring cycle of her departure and the subsequent darkness that envelops his life.

Overall, "Ain't No Sunshine" is a poignant and introspective song that delves into the emotional turmoil caused by the absence of a loved one. Through its evocative lyrics and soulful delivery, the song captures the universal experience of longing and emptiness when someone we care about is not by our side.
